Official 2.0 Release
Posted by GEN3RIC at 4:58 am on June 30, 2010
On Wednesday, DICE will deliver the simultaneous release of the R8 client and R15 servers. The next version of BC2CC will take advantage of all the new features built into the new server protocol. Before you all rush off to install this, please note that your server must be upgraded in order for you to connect to it. With this revision we are introducing a new installation package which provides a much easier installation and updating procedure.
You will not have to set your servers up again and your preferences will be saved, so the upgrade process should be painless. BC2CC requires the .NET 4 Framework, and if it is not installed, the installer will provide a link for you to download and install. No restart is necessary. You can install this update parallel to your current version of 1.2.1, so if you have older servers, use the old version of BC2CC. The new version will warn you if you attempt to connect to a server that is not compatible.
So what’s in this release? Lots. DICE gave us plenty of facetime with the new rcon protocol so we have some exciting features. Here’s the rundown.
Player List
- Tickets displayed on player list
- Player kit info is visualized by mouse over
- Session actions: restart round, skip round, or end round (allows you to choose the winner)
- Kit Icon for players
- Improved Kick/Ban system [allows you to write in a reason]
Server List
- More accurate player counts
- Restart a server which you are connected to (warning, any server variables not set in startup.txt could be overwritten)
Map Options
- Drag & Drop maps to and from the playlist
Server Options
- Allowed to set the server name from the tool now
- Server description length is 400 chars and a pipe ‘|’ inserts a line break
- Addition of idle timeout (0 removes the timeout entirely)
- Enable/Disable the profanity filter in chat
- Advanced Team Kill rules
- Per-Level variable customization
Miscellaneous
- Reserved slots was improved in server code. Add as many to the list as you want, it will not reduce your max capacity
- Added admin console to directly execute commands for advanced users
- Yell from chat area allows you to choose the duration (saves to preferences)
- Welcome Message (found in server details. Right click server > Edit) is now sent when the player spawns. Make sure to change this, it is now recommended to be 0-10 seconds
Auto Admin
- Kill Streak
- Choose advanced options like when the streak starts and what the intervals are
- Set custom phrases for beginning, continuing, and ending a streak. Hover over the text box to see the variables to use in your phrase
- First Kill / First Dogtag
- Notify the server of the first kill of the match
- Dogtag mode lets you set a custom phrase for when the first dogtags are taken
- Ace Player
- If somebody is leading the pack, this lets the server know.
- Set it to a timed interval so they aren’t annoyed by the notifications
- Choose custom phrases for notifications with variables (hover over to see them)
- Name & Shame
- A potentially hilarious mod that will notify the server if somebody is killed with an embarrassing weapon.
- Choose from a preset list of weapons that are difficult or embarrassing to kill with
- Set a custom phrase for each weapon
- Assassination
- This mode lets players volunteer themselves to be assassins.
- 2 players are pitted against each other. Others may help, but YOU must kill them to win
- Optionally, you can allow the player to know the kit they’re using, and every time they spawn they are updated
- Time limited
- Always-On function will keep the ball rolling as long as it’s enabled. Otherwise, an in-game command must be used to start the game.
- War
- For serious league play.
- Enter a phrase, and a countdown (in seconds), and when the countdown reaches 0, the map restarts, thus beginning a live match
- Optionally, players can !ready before the match will start
- Public Commands
- !admins
- show admins registered on the server
- !calladmin
- send a message to all admins
- !disconnect
- a fun and frivolous way to disconnect!
- !serverinfo
- see the vital information of the server like maplist, server name, etc
- !statsme
- view stats of how many times you’ve killed or died, grouped by weapon
- !maplist
- returns the maplist
- Notifications
- Alert the server when an admin is joining the game
- Advertise that you are using BC2CC and that public commands exist. This is an unobtrusive message flashed once when they join. (Recommended to use “say” mode)
- !admins
That’s a big update! So what’s not in this update? Missing in this update is a !rules public command which will display a list of rules you have set. This will eliminate the need to use Punkbuster Tasks (an overtly complicated and message system), handy if you are not using PB. Also, these rules can optionally be displayed when a player enters the server. Class and weapon restrictions are also not included in this release, but will be added shortly. Please note, restrictions cannot be added if you are running a ranked server due to the server TOS. If it were allowed, your server can and likely will be canceled. Also missing: tight server/Twitter integration with possibility to respond to @mentions and adds with in-game notifications of followers. This will be heavily tested prior to release to ensure there is no abuse. Votekick will be added in the next few days, look for an update when you start BC2CC.
Why? Because things take a long time, and this is our hobby. Support us if you appreciate what we do for you!
Download
420kb Installer
4.5mb download



Assassination was fun dude, good job on the new tool.
Wheres the plugins?
It is getting too easy to be an admin! Quit making these EZ-Tools!!!!
Nice job
Hey, just wondering what the status is with the daemon support ?
Regards Andreas
Can you add “add to erserved slots” in context menu from online players?
Hallo
I have some problems …. if i change some server settings and push SAVE buttone … server restarts/crash …. if i try to unban a player …. server restarts/crash ??? whats wrong ???
Greetz Marv
imyourkiller – I was just going to add that tonight.
Weird coincidence.
Marv,
I haven’t heard of that happening before. Would you mind if I logged into your server and tested it?
ok i tried when server is empty and nothing happen…. hmmm don know why
servername= Deutschland 2010 +Rush+PBBans+Ranked+
Marvman, email me your server ip, command port, and RCON password (a temp one would be a good idea) at eric.rode@gmail.com and I can see if I can reproduce it. If I can’t reproduce it, I cannot fix it.
eric…@gmail.com …. ok but i could not see hole email adress
email is on the way
Update: Determined Marvman’s issue was server issues, not BC2CC itself.
thx a lot good job
2.0 is good, nice updates but BC2CC automatically updated itself today and something is wrong with PB tasks. Tasks were working fine yesterday but today (I’m guessing after the update) only the first 8 tasks on the list are viewed as server messages (I’ve put 10 tasks, so the last 2 messages are never sent by the server. I’ve tried saving and loading, clearing and re-writing the tasks, etc. but it’s no good. I’m sure the time settings are fine since I tried re-writing them like 10 times and everything was working fine yesterday. Thanks.
Btw, an RSS feed for comments? Nice idea.
You could use this feed, for all comments on the site. http://feeds.feedburner.com/CommentsForBc2cc
it would be good to watch what used vehicles which players
AtzeGlatze – that information is not supplied to us. If it’s added to the server, then we’ll make use of it.